Grenada....beautiful Grenada

Some of us from work went on a 5 hour tour of some of the island. We went into some nook and crannies, as well as some other places along the coast.

Included in the stops was the Grenada Chocolate Factory. Anyone who has tasted the chocolate might be surprised to see the small building it is manufactured in. They recently won another Bronze Award given out by the Academy of Chocolate of which Michel Roux is the Patron (he is a famous chef).
